In the new documentary “How To Make Money Selling Drugs,” rapper Eminem talks about his past drug addiction problems and near death experiences.

Eminem’s problem with drug addition comes as no surprise to his fans. He has been very vocal about his struggles in the past and even let a few instances loose during his rap verses. In the new documentary, Em takes through a time where he almost died from a pain pill overdose.

In “How To Make Money Selling Drugs,” Em tells viewers how his addiction to painkillers started and revisits the night he almost overdosed on Vicodin.

“When I took my first Vicodin, it was like this feeling of ‘ahh.’ Like everything was not only mellow, but didn’t feel any pain,” shared Eminem. “It just kind of numbed things. I don’t know at what point exactly it started to be a problem, I just remember liking it more and more.”

As with most drug addicts, it took Eminem a while to come to terms with his addiction. Oblivious to the fact that he developed a real problem, he just continued to use. It wasn’t until he found himself in the hospital after one particular binge that Eminem acknowledged his problem head on.

“Had I have got to the hospital about two hours later, I would have died. My organs were shutting down. My liver, kidneys, everything. They were gonna have to put me on dialysis. They didn’t think I was gonna make it. My bottom was gonna be death,” added Em.

“How To Make Money Selling Drugs” is directed by Matthew Cooke and produced by Adrian Grenier of “Entourage” fame. It had its theatrical release over the weekend in NY and LA.
